Related Article Tags: , , , If your employer offers a matching contribution to your retirement plan, the cardinal rule is: contribute whatever the employer is willing to match. Even if your employer is only willing to make a partial match up to a cap, you should still take advantage of this opportunity. We are often asked this question: What happens if the beneficiary was unemployed for a period of time before a new employer files an H-1B transfer petition? Our experience is that the USCIS uses its discretion and approves the transfer with change of status when the unemployment period is comparatively short.
